The Minister of Arts, Culture, Tourism and Creative Economy, Hannatu Musa Musawa is expected to grace Nigeria Tourism Investment Forum and Exhibition (NTIFE) 2025 as Chief Host.
NTIFE, the annual event, organised by the Federation of Tourism Associations of Nigeria (FTAN) usually bring together state governments, investors, policymakers, tourism professionals, foreign envoys, and international partners to chart new pathways to ensure Nigeria’s tourism growth. This year’s edition of NTIFE is no exception.

The Forum, scheduled to hold in the Federal Capital Territory (FCT), Abuja on November 28, 2025 will attract ambassadors,
heads of corporate bodies and the Directors General of parastatals in the Tourism Ministry and other MDAs.
The ‘Special Guests’
list include Director Generals of the Nigerian Tourism Development (NTDA), Olayiwola Awakan; National Institute for Hospitality and Tourism (NIHOTOUR), Abisoye Fagade; National Gallery of Arts (NGA), Ahmed Bashir Sodangi; National Commission for Museums and Monument (NCMM), Olugbile Holloway; and National Information Technology Development Agency (NITDA), Kashifu Inuwa Abdullahi.
The Federation announced ace journalist, public analyst and current affairs commentator, Mr Babajide Kolade-Otitoju, who is Head of Current Affairs, TVC News, Lagos, as the Keynote Speaker for the Forum, with the theme; National Tourism Investment and Global Partnership.
The panelists include Ngozi Ngoka, Managing Director, Zigona Travel Advisory; Dr. Tony Elumelu, former Director, Private Sector Department, ECOWAS Commission; Dr. Victor Dare, Group Managing Director, Better Ways Group; Prince Philip Orebiyi, General Manager, Kogi State Hotel Board; and Mr. Victor Kayode, President, Nigeria Hotel and Catering Institute (NHCI).
